EnterpriseDB Executive Honored for Commitment to Open Source/PostgreSQL

Bruce Momjian Recognized as 'Database Jedi Master' at the Recently Held
O'Reilly Open Source Convention, OSCON 2009
WESTFORD, Mass., Aug. 17 /PRNewswire/ -- EnterpriseDB, the leading
enterprise-class open source database company, today announced that its Senior
Database Architect Bruce Momjian, a recognized leader of the PostgreSQL open
source community, was presented with an award for his work on PostgreSQL.
Momjian was selected from the hundreds of nominations received, and was
conferred the status of 'Database Jedi Master' by the Google-O'Reilly Open
Source Award committee. The award is presented to individuals for dedication,
innovation, leadership and outstanding contribution to open source.
"This award isn't just for me - it belongs to the entire Postgres community,"
said Momjian. "The developer community supporting PostgreSQL is the
technology's greatest strength and through a constant process of reviewing,
improving and refining code, this community has created the world's most
advanced open source database."
In addition to his role as Senior Database Architect at EnterpriseDB, Momjian
is a member of the Postgres Core Team and is also a Postgres Committer, one of
the select few with the authority to permit changes to the official Postgres
code base. He is a co-founder of the PostgreSQL Global Development Group and
has worked on Postgres since 1996. Bruce is also the author of PostgreSQL:
Introduction and Concepts, published by Addison-Wesley.
